The Iveco Stralis utilizes sophisticated electronic systems to manage engine, braking, and drivetrain components. Fault codes, often displayed on the instrument cluster or read via diagnostic tools like IVECO E.A.SY., provide crucial insights into system malfunctions.
Based on technical documents, these faults generally categorized under Engine Control (EDC), Transmission (ZF Astronic), and Braking systems (EBS). Common Iveco Stralis Fault Codes
Here are some of the key fault codes encountered in Iveco Stralis vehicles, particularly in Euro 4/5 models:
0111 - Vehicle Speed Sensor Circuit: Indicates a malfunction in the speed sensor circuit, which can affect transmission shifting and cruise control.
0112 - Acceleration Pedal Sensor Circuit: Signals a fault in pedal sensor 1, which may cause limp mode or unresponsive acceleration.
0113 - Brake/Accelerator Signal Mismatch: Often indicates a mismatch between the brake pedal switch and accelerator sensors, potentially a safety feature trigger.
0116 - Clutch Switch Circuit: Indicates a fault in the clutch pedal switch, crucial for manual or automated manual transmissions.
0117 - Brake Pedal Switch Malfunction: Incorrect signal from the brake pedal switch.
0119 - Controller Voltage Loss: Loss of voltage (terminal 15) to the control module.
0122 - MIL/Check Engine Light Malfunction: A fault in the Malfunction Indicator Lamp (MIL) circuit.
0126 - System Voltage Outside Operating Range: Indicates voltage issues from the controller.
0131/0132 - Coolant Temperature Sensor: Malfunction or incorrect signal from the coolant sensor, critical for engine protection.

40B01 - Wheel Sensor Left Front: This code frequently points to a faulty speed sensor, air gap issues, or a wiring short. If the air gap is too large, the sensor output voltage is too low.
Air Gap Too Large: Requires checking the ABS sensor seating and pole wheel teeth.
ABS/ASR Disabled: Often occurs when speed differences between wheels are too great, indicating a potential issue with tire circumference or wheel speed sensors. 2. Engine Control (EDC) Faults

In an IVECO Stralis, RFC (Rear Frame Computer) fault codes generally relate to electrical issues in the rear section of the vehicle, including external lighting and air pressure sensors. These faults are often triggered by incorrect bulb wattages, corroded wiring, or failing sensors. Ивеко Форум Common RFC Fault Codes & Meanings

Understanding the RFC Fault Code Display
On the Iveco Stralis, fault codes are typically displayed in a specific string: (Diagnostic Trouble Code), (Failure Mode Identifier), (Occurrence Counter), and (Active status). DTC (Diagnostic Trouble Code): The specific number identifying which component is failing. FMI (Failure Mode Identifier): Indicates the
of failure (e.g., short circuit to ground, open circuit, or signal out of range). OC (Occurrence Counter): Shows how many times the fault has happened. ACT (Active):
"Y" means the fault is currently present; "N" means it is a stored historical fault. Common RFC Fault Codes & Meanings Report: Iveco Stralis RFC Fault Codes The Anatomy

If you see an RFC fault, you can often narrow it down without a heavy-duty scanner by following these steps: Inspect Bulbs:
Many RFC errors are triggered by simple blown bulbs or using the wrong wattage. Check all trailer and rear tractor lights. Check Connectors:
The rear frame is exposed to salt, water, and debris. Inspect the large electrical connectors (often near the air dryer or under the expansion tank) for "green" corrosion or broken wires. Sensor Validation:
For pressure-related RFC codes (like DTC 09), the sensor on top of the Air Processing Unit (APU) is a common failure point due to excessive air pressure. Wiring Harness:
Check the entry points where wires enter the protective "corrugated" tubing, as they often snap due to vibration. Iveco Форум

Comprehensive Guide to Iveco Stralis RFC Fault Codes In the Iveco Stralis, RFC stands for Rear Frame Computer. This specialized control unit manages the electrical systems located at the back of the vehicle, primarily overseeing the rear lighting, trailer connections, and various chassis-mounted sensors. When an RFC fault code appears on your dashboard, it indicates an issue with these rear components or the communication between the RFC and the main vehicle computer. Understanding the RFC System
The RFC is a black, snap-on covered box located inside the chassis, often positioned behind the diesel tank. It is typically manufactured by Bosch and is held in place by three 8mm bolts. This module communicates with the rest of the truck via the CAN line (Controller Area Network).
If your dashboard displays "RFC not communicating," it often suggests that the unit has lost power or the module itself has failed. Common RFC Fault Codes and Meanings
RFC faults usually manifest as errors related to lighting or sensor signals from the rear frame. While specific numeric codes can vary by model year (Euro 4, 5, or 6), they generally fall into these categories:
Lighting Anomalies: These are the most frequent RFC alerts. They often require checking the rear bulbs, lamp holders, and wiring for corrosion or short circuits.
Sensor Failures: Issues with the hydraulic fluid level indicator, engine oil pressure signals, or alternator signals routed through the rear harness.
Air Pressure Errors: A "Stralis RFC fault" can sometimes be traced to a defective air pressure sensor on the Air Processing Unit (Air Dryer), located in the middle of the chassis.
PTO (Power Take-Off) Issues: Faults may arise if the RFC does not receive the "ON" signal or if there is a short circuit in the PTO relay or solenoid valves. Potential Fault Area Rear Lights

The Rear Frame Computer (RFC) on an Iveco Stralis is an essential control module responsible for managing electrical components at the rear of the vehicle, including lighting, sensors, and trailer communications. RFC fault codes typically indicate issues ranging from simple bulb failures to critical communication errors on the Controller Area Network (CAN) bus. Common Iveco Stralis RFC Fault Codes
RFC codes are often displayed as a Diagnostic Trouble Code (DTC) accompanied by a Failure Mode Identifier (FMI), which specifies the type of electrical fault (e.g., short circuit or open circuit). Component/System Common Description 0105 / 0106 Dipped Beam (Right) Open circuit or short circuit in the right-side headlight. 0405 Dipped Beam (Left) Open circuit detected in the left-side headlight. 0606 Reverse Light
Short circuit detected in the trailer reverse light circuit. 0805 / 0806 Trailer Indicator (Right)
Open circuit or short circuit in the right-side trailer direction indicator. 0900 / 0901 Front Axle Pressure Sensor
Signal value is above or below the acceptable operating limit. 1305 / 1306 Left Direction Indicator Open or short circuit in the left-side turn signal. 1605 / 1606 Trailer Stop Light (Left) Open or short circuit in the left-side trailer brake light. 1705 / 1706 Rear Fog Light Open or short circuit in the rear fog light system. 2202 BCB CAN Line
Communication failure between the RFC and the Body Computer. System Pins and Signals (RFC Connector)
The RFC uses specific pins to monitor and control various vehicle signals. Faults on these lines often trigger the codes listed above: Pin 1: Alternator signal. Pin 3: Engine oil pressure sensor signal. Pin 5: Positive supply for left rear position lights. Pin 10: CAN-H & L (BCB) communication lines. Pin 13: Positive supply for rear fog lights. Troubleshooting and Root Causes
Most RFC faults stem from physical damage to the electrical system rather than computer failure.
Wiring Harness Damage: Wires can break if wrapped too tightly or exposed to excessive vibration, leading to "ghost faults" or intermittent signal loss.
Corrosion: Connectors around the RFC box and fuse panels are prone to moisture ingress, which causes poor ground connections.
Power Surges: Jumping the vehicle with excessive power can permanently damage the RFC, Front Frame Computer (FFC), and Body Computer (BC).
Ground Issues: Check earth straps and clean contact points, as bad grounds frequently send false error signals to the ECU.
To clear "ghost faults," some technicians recommend a soft reset by disconnecting the battery for approximately 15 minutes before re-checking for active codes. IVECO Stralis RFC Fault Codes Guide | PDF - Scribd
